Description

{1} Of the 20 trenches excavated, only seven contained features of archaeological interest. The enclosures identified by the geophysical survey were shown to date to the lat Iron Age and early Roman period, specifically 1st - 2nd centuries AD. An apparently circular enclosure ditch in Trench 8 was undated.
